欢迎访问网络基础指南网
电脑基础教程及相关技术编程入门基础技能・网络基础指南
合作联系QQ2707014640
联系我们
电脑基础教程涵盖硬件解析、系统操作到实用工具技巧,从认识主机构造到熟练运用办公软件,搭配视频演示和步骤图解,助你轻松搞定系统重装、文件恢复等问题,快速提升电脑操作效率。​ 编程入门聚焦 Python、Java 等热门语言基础,以制作简易小程序、网页交互效果为导向,用趣味案例讲解语法逻辑,配套在线编程环境,让零基础者也能逐步掌握代码编写技能。​ 网络基础指南解析网络架构、设备配置及安全防护,通过模拟家庭组网、故障排查场景,教你设置 IP 地址、优化 WiFi 信号,全方位掌握网络应用必备知识,轻松应对日常网络问题。
您的位置: 首页>>网络技术>>正文
网络技术

计算机如何说话,从文字到语音的奇妙旅程

时间:2025-08-26 作者:技术大佬 点击:1511次

,想象一下,冰冷的计算机如何能发出我们熟悉的声音,甚至模仿人类说话?这背后是一个从静默文字到生动声音的奇妙旅程,是现代语音合成技术的魔法,计算机“说话”的核心在于将书面语言——那些由字母和符号组成的文本——转换成我们耳朵能捕捉到的声波,这个过程并非自然而然,而是依赖于复杂的技术和算法。早期的方法,如基于声码器的系统,试图通过分析和重建语音的物理特性(如基频、共振峰)来合成声音,另一种方法是波形拼接,它更像是“乐高”游戏,从庞大的语音片段数据库中挑选并组合出目标单词和句子,随着技术进步,特别是深度学习的引入,现代语音合成变得越来越逼真和自然,神经网络能够学习海量的语音数据,捕捉语音的细微模式,从而生成听起来几乎与真人无异的合成语音。从文字到语音的旅程,不仅涉及复杂的信号处理和人工智能,更代表了人机交互方式的革新,让信息的获取和表达变得更加便捷和生动,这趟旅程揭示了数字世界赋予机器“发声”能力的奥秘,也预示着未来更智能、更自然的人机对话时代。

大家好!今天咱们来聊聊一个特别酷的话题——计算机怎么把文字变成我们能听到的声音,这可不是什么科幻电影里的黑科技,而是正在你手机里默默工作的实用技术,想象一下,当你对着手机说话就能发送消息,或者导航软件用温柔的声音告诉你转弯路线,这些都离不开语音技术的支撑,就让我们一起走进这个神奇的数字声音世界!

技术原理大揭秘

传统语音合成技术 还记得小时候听过的"电子蜜蜂"吗?那种刺耳难听的机器声就是最早的语音合成技术,传统方法主要分三步:

  • 文本预处理:把汉字拆成拼音,英文分词
  • 声学建模:用数学公式计算每个音节的声波参数
  • 声码器:把数字信号转换成实际声音

那时候的语音听起来就像机器人,因为它们没有情感,每个音节都机械重复,不过随着技术发展,现在的语音合成已经能模仿各种声线了!

计算机如何说话,从文字到语音的奇妙旅程

现代神经网络技术 现在的语音合成主要靠深度学习,特别是2016年左右兴起的端到端语音合成技术,就像教孩子说话一样,系统需要大量真实语音数据进行训练:

技术演进对比表:

技术类型 代表技术 优缺点 应用场景
传统TTS diphone、formant 音质差、缺乏情感 早期导航系统
现代TTS WaveNet、Tacotron 高质量、可定制 智能助手
实时合成 DeepVoice、Tacotron2 速度快、可交互 会议同传

语音合成三要素 要让计算机真正"说话",需要解决三个关键问题:

  • 音素转换:把文字转换成基本发音单位
  • 语调控制:模拟人类说话的起伏变化
  • 情感表达:让声音有喜怒哀乐

应用场景大放送

  1. 智能助手的幕后英雄 你每天和Siri、小爱同学对话,背后就是语音合成技术,不过现在的智能助手已经能根据语境调整说话方式了,比如当你问"今天天气怎么样",它会用轻松愉快的语气回答;而如果是紧急情况,它会提高音量加快语速。

  2. 视障人士的福音 对于盲人朋友来说,语音技术简直是生活神器,从手机操作系统到电子书,都能通过语音方式提供帮助,很多盲人甚至能通过语音合成设备完成工作和学习。

  3. 教育领域的创新 你见过会说话的英语教材吗?现在很多教育软件都能用不同口音、不同语速的语音来帮助学习,特别是一些儿童英语学习APP,还能模仿小朋友的语气说话,让学习变得更有趣。

  4. 娱乐产业的新玩法 游戏开发者现在可以用语音合成技术创造更真实的NPC对话,上古卷轴》系列游戏中的角色,每个说话都有独特的口音和情感变化。

技术挑战与未来

  1. 情感表达的瓶颈 目前的语音合成技术虽然能模仿各种声线,但还很难真正传达情感,比如你很难让计算机模仿出"伤心"或"愤怒"的真实语气,这也是目前技术最大的短板。

  2. 实时交互的难题 高质量的语音合成需要大量计算资源,这在实时交互场景中是个挑战,不过随着硬件性能提升和算法优化,这个问题正在逐步解决。

  3. 多语言支持的挑战 目前的语音合成技术在小语种支持上还很有限,这也是很多初创公司正在努力突破的方向。

    计算机如何说话,从文字到语音的奇妙旅程

  1. 更自然的语音体验 未来的语音合成技术可能会像人类说话一样自然,甚至能根据对方的情绪调整自己的语气,想象一下,你的智能助手能根据你的喜好改变说话方式,这不再是科幻小说的情节了。

  2. 实时翻译的进步 随着语音合成和语音识别技术的结合,实时翻译将变得更加流畅自然,你甚至可以在国际会议上直接用语音进行实时翻译,再也不用担心语言障碍了。

  3. 个性化语音定制 未来我们可能能创建完全属于自己的"数字声音",用于各种场景,比如你可以创建一个温柔的电子声音用于工作,一个活泼的声音用于娱乐。

问答环节:

Q:语音合成和语音识别有什么区别? A:语音合成是把文字变成声音,语音识别是把声音变回文字,它们就像一对孪生兄弟,常常一起使用。

Q:为什么有些语音听起来很假? A:这通常是因为训练数据不足或者模型参数设置不当,就像教孩子说话需要大量真实语料,计算机也需要大量高质量的语音数据来学习。

案例分享:疫情期间,很多医院使用语音合成技术录制健康宣教材料,既保证了信息传播的及时性,又避免了医护人员过度劳累,有些医院甚至开发了能根据不同病情提供个性化建议的语音助手,大大提高了工作效率。

从最初的机械发声到如今的智能语音,计算机"说话"技术已经走过了一段不平凡的旅程,虽然目前还存在一些技术瓶颈,但随着人工智能的飞速发展,我们有理由相信,未来的语音技术将更加智能、自然,为我们的生活带来更多惊喜,也许在不久的将来,你我之间的交流,不仅限于文字和图像,声音也将成为数字世界中最自然的表达方式。

知识扩展阅读

【开场白】 "小王,这份报告用语音读给我听!"领导在群里发来语音请求,刚学完AI的运营小张手忙脚乱,别慌!今天我们就来解锁这个让电脑开口说话的魔法,整个过程就像给电脑装了个"金嗓子",关键步骤、常见问题和实战案例我都整理好了,看完保证你也能玩转语音转换!

语音转换三要素:你电脑到底在"说话"吗? (图1:语音转换流程示意图)

语音识别(STT):把声音转文字

计算机如何说话,从文字到语音的奇妙旅程

  • 原理:麦克风→声波→数字信号→识别文字
  • 案例:讯飞输入法实时转文字,准确率92%
  • 现场测试:对着手机说"今天天气不错",屏幕立即显示文字

语音合成(TTS):让电脑开口说话

  • 原理:文字→音素→波形→音频文件
  • 案例:微软小冰用不同声线讲故事
  • 现场测试:输入"你好",电脑用"郭德纲"声线朗读

技术融合:识别+合成的双重奏

  • 实战场景:智能客服先听问题(STT),再用标准话术回答(TTS)
  • 典型应用:导航软件实时读路线,同时记录导航日志

技术全家桶大比拼(表格1) | 工具名称 | 识别准确率 | 合成自然度 | 支持语言 | 价格模式 | |----------|------------|------------|----------|----------| | 讯飞听见 | 98% | 4.8/5 | 30+ | 按分钟计费 | | Google语音 | 95% | 4.5/5 | 100+ | 免费版限500h | | Azure语音 | 97% | 4.7/5 | 50+ | 按调用次数 | | 哈工大语音 | 95% | 4.6/5 | 20+ | 买断制 |

实战指南:三步打造你的专属语音助手

准备工作(图2:硬件配置建议)

  • 基础配置:双核CPU+4G内存+16G存储
  • 采集设备:领夹麦(-40dB降噪)
  • 环境要求:安静环境+10cm以上采集距离
  1. 常用工具操作手册 (图3:讯飞听见操作流程) ① 上传文件:选择MP3/WAV格式(推荐32kHz采样率) ② 选择模板:新闻播报/学术报告/会议记录 ③ 下载结果:支持导出MP3/AIFF格式 ④ 验证质量:用Audacity检查错字(设置0.3dB动态范围)

  2. API调用实战(Python示例)

    import speech_recognition as sr

def stt_to_text(): r = sr.Recognizer() with sr.Microphone() as source: print("正在录音...") audio = r.listen(source) try: text = r.recognize_google(audio, language='zh-CN') print("识别结果:{}".format(text)) except Exception as e: print("识别失败:{}".format(e))

tts_to_audio = lambda text: open("output.mp3","wb").write(google_tts(text))


四、避坑指南:这些错误千万别犯!
(问答Q&A)
Q:转换时总出现"嗯嗯"杂音怎么办?
A:检查麦克风是否接触皮肤,开启环境降噪(参数设置:-50dB静音阈,0.8秒静音检测)
Q:中文识别总把"的"认成"地"?
A:使用专业版ASR模型(如阿里云智能语音),设置"中文分词"参数为"精确"
Q:合成声音像机器人怎么办?
A:调整音调参数(Pitch=2.0),增加停顿标记(<PAUSE>200ms)
五、行业应用全景图
1. 智能家居:小度音箱识别方言指令
2. 教育领域:AI教师用不同语速讲解知识点
3. 医疗系统:电子病历自动转语音播报
4. 物流管理:无人车实时播报配送信息
六、未来趋势:你的声音能被"盗用"吗?
1. 隐私保护:端到端加密(如华为鸿蒙的语音安全框架)
2. 伦理挑战:AI换脸+语音合成伪造视频
3. 技术突破:神经合成(WaveNet)实现个性化声纹
【
从识别到合成的完整链路就像搭积木:先确定需求(文字转语音还是语音转文字),选择合适工具(开源/商用),最后用API或客户端快速集成,三要三不要":要测试多场景,要检查降噪,要备份数据;不要用免费工具处理敏感信息,不要忽略声纹安全,不要过度依赖单一平台。
(全文共计1582字,包含5个图示、3个表格、12个案例、23个技术参数)

相关的知识点:

全天候黑客服务,24/7接单的可靠性探讨

【科普】输入微信号调取他人的聊天记录

如何才能远程接收老公出轨聊天记录,【看这4种方法】

百科科普黑客接单,揭开网络黑产的神秘面纱

百科科普揭秘QQ黑客接单群,深入了解背后的风险与法律边界

百科科普揭秘黑客手机定位接单网站——违法犯罪的警示